Funny text message blunders thanks to 'Auto-correct' ver. 2.0

BlackBerry users are easy to spot.  The "mo" (as in, kumusta mo ako) on their text messages somehow comes out as "month" (kumusta month ako). Well, at least the word "Panic" doesn't suddenly auto-correct itself to say "Pancake" like on an iPhone.

Your smartphone can be a dumb-ass at times when it comes to auto-predicting words. Many were already victimized in fact that this website dedicated its content in gathering these awkwardly funny texts. Our advice to careless texters: Turn off that damn predictive text feature from your mobile device. Better yet, scroll through the list of auto-correct words and edit entries that can potentially lead to your social demise.
